Campbell Memorial High School seniors, above, pledged to Plant the Promise of maintaining a healthy and drug-free life during Red Ribbon Week in October. Red tulip bulbs were planted around the school’s main entrance as a pledge by 30 seniors to serve as a reminder to all students about the importance of a drug-free life. The campaign is part of the National Plant the Promise Campaign.
